The interview process was unique and enjoyable. I got the opportunity to meet with multiple team members as part of the process which I appreciate. Being a remote candidate, all the interviews were done over video conference. Rounds included, initial phone screen by a colleague, 2 follow-up second round 1 hour interviews, a discussion with HR, 1 week Medallia challenge, final round of interview with three 1 hour discussions. Everyone felt very vested in the interview process and took the time to answer my questions. I felt welcomed to their culture. It surely was a more human way of interviewing.
It felt like the company has its heart in the right place. The interview process overall left a very positive impression on me and was one of the biggest factor in me accepting the job.

1. In-house recruiter reached out.
2. Spoke with recruiter for 1 hour.
3. Was told they would schedule time for me with the hiring manager. Was also told this would be an extremely quick 1-2 weeks process with only an interview with the hiring manager and offer as they were desperate to quickly fill the position. I was ok with this as I was deep in other interview stages and needed a speedy process.
4. Day of the interview with the hiring manager arrives and 1 hour before they cancel.
5. New recruiter reaches out to reschedule the hiring manager interview a couple of days later, I agree and schedule it.
6. 2nd day of hiring manager interview arrives. The hiring manager arrives on the call 8 minutes later, but apologies, he tells me that the first recruiter I spoke with was let go and it mangled things up. Odd place to start but ok. Next instead of interviewing me he asked me for detailed processes on my prior companies and even goes as far as to ask for linkedin pages for people I have managed and/or who have managed me. I gave him as much detail as possible but explained to him that I felt uncomfortable with some of the questions and that I still had active NDA's.
7. Interview ended I thought it was overall and the new recruiter tells me I have another stage to meet and greet with peers and some of the team.
8. Interviewed with the team and peers in a 3 hour session which went really well.
9. Next the new recruiter tells me I need to do a challenge project and present it to 3 people.
10. At this stage I reach back out to the recruiter as we're 3 weeks into a process that I was told prior would only be 1-2 weeks and tell her that I have offers coming in and this interview process is not what I originally agreed to but I'll do the challenge if she can schedule quickly and give me the challenges needed resources (it was missing excel data sheets).
11. She follows back up in 2 days apologies and then randomly gives me a totally different 2 part challenge and says I'll need to present it to around 10 people instead of 3....
12. At this point the position wasn't worth it and I had a better offer. I provided feedback but it was a horrible experience overall. If this is how they treat their interviewee imagine how bad they treat their employees.
